Research and Design for Intelligent Control Algorithm of the LF Furnace Electrode

By the way of build a new model to intuitively response the temperature changes in the refining furnace, using the results of the temperature changes to control the output of the current, and achieve the purpose of accurate control and not waste resources. Combining temperature prediction with this model, complete the adjustment work together. By the simulation shows that use this control method can adjust the current output reasonably. By this way the efficiency of electrode regulating system can be improved, and fit the practical requirement in production more.
